Über diesen Titel

“Lucy Parker writes deliciously fun enemies-to-lovers perfection!” — Tessa Bailey, New York Times bestselling author

Beloved author Lucy Parker pens a delicious new romantic comedy that is a battle of whisks and wits.

Ready…

Four years ago, Sylvie Fairchild charmed the world as a contestant on the hit baking show, Operation Cake. Her ingenious, creations captivated viewers and intrigued all but one of the judges, Dominic De Vere. When Sylvie's unicorn cake went spectacularly sideways, Dominic was quick to vote her off the show. Since then, Sylvie has used her fame to fulfill her dream of opening a bakery. The toast of Instagram, Sugar Fair has captured the attention of the Operation Cake producers…and a princess.

Set…

Dominic is His Majesty the King’s favorite baker and a veritable British institution. He’s brilliant, talented, hard-working. And an icy, starchy grouch. Learning that Sylvie will be joining him on the Operation Cake judging panel is enough to make the famously dour baker even more grim. Her fantastical baking is only slightly more troublesome than the fact that he can’t stop thinking about her pink-streaked hair and irrepressible dimple.

Match…

When Dominic and Sylvie learn they will be fighting for the once in a lifetime opportunity to bake a cake for the upcoming wedding of Princess Rose, the flour begins to fly as they fight to come out on top.

The bride adores Sylvie’s quirky style. The palace wants Dominic’s classic perfection.

In this royal battle, can there be room for two?

With its quirky characters, witty humor, and mouth-watering descriptions of baked goods, Battle Royal is the perfect beach read for fans of contemporary romance and the Great British Bake Off.

This book was a delight from start to finish. The description makes it seem like the book is going to be mainly about Sylvie and Dominic coming into conflict and competition with each other, with plenty of funny hijinks, banter and maybe some light-hearted sabotage as they slowly fall for each other. It turns out there is much less of that than I expected, but I am far from disappointed with what the book delivered instead.

As you'd expect, it does not take long for the attraction between the two mains to be felt, but in a refreshing contrast from what might be expected from typical enemies-to-lovers romance, the author does not spend half the book on them resisting the pull with all their might while pining about each other and internally bemoaning how they can't afford to get close.

Instead, as the plot begins to ramp up and problems appear that the protagonists must deal with, they go from conspicuously failing to interfere with each other for the sake of their enmity to casually talking, not-so-casually confiding in each other and eventually supporting each other as they get closer over the course of the book. The slow build of trust is heart-warming and sweet, and it feels like a natural development when they ultimately get together, rather than hormones getting the better of them. There are no dramatic betrayals or misunderstandings or foolish self-destructive behavior here, which I appreciate more than I can say.

There's plenty of surrounding plot providing a backdrop to this romance to keep things from getting boring. The narrator does an excellent job with both the humor and the feels. All in all, a book I unreservedly recommend to anyone who likes their romance a little more subdued with a steady and healthy buildup of trust, rather than a storm of hormones, clichés and high drama.
